FEDERATION OF AWBRIDGE & WELLOW PRIMARY SCHOOLS
 

The Governing Body is a group of volunteers, each bringing a different set of skills and experience, who work with both schools in a variety of ways. Governors take a strategic role and do not become involved in the day-to-day running of the schools. They support and challenge the schools and are accountable for the schools’ decisions. They are also responsible for the selection and appointment of the Executive Head Teacher. In accordance with our constitution the following 15 people form the Governing Body to the Federation of Awbridge and Wellow Primary Schools:

 

6 Parent governors –
3 from Awbridge and 3 from Wellow
When there is a vacancy, the school will invite applications from their parents. If more than one parent puts their name forward the Governor is then elected by the parents from the school with the vacancy

3 Staff governors
(including the head teacher)
To provide balance, there is usually one teaching and one non-teaching staff governor, with one being appointed from one school and one from the other school.

3 Authority governors
These governors are appointed by the designated person within the Local Authority (currently Mr Roy Perry) and have no particular allegiance to either school

3 Community governors
When there is a vacancy, the Governing Body invites applications from people in the local communities. These governors also have no particular allegiance to either school

Associate members
Associate members are invited to join the Governing Body when there is a need for a particular set of skills or experience that does not currently exist in the GB. They do not have a vote and membership will be for a defined short or long term period
